Beta2 wont install, it says "Status 7" assert failed: getprop("ro.product.device") == "blade"

From the first post:

It looks like Sebastian's recovery images don't set any identifier values, so the assert in the install script will fails. Either use this modified version of Sebastian's 3.0.0.5 ClockWorkMod until the necessary values are added, or disable asserts before flashing (its an option in the "install zip from sdcard" menu).

I have a temporary fix for the wrong homebutton.

A even better fix:

Change

key 102   ENDCALL		   WAKE_DROPPED
to
key 102   HOME			  WAKE

in /system/usr/keylayout/qwerty.kl
